What is financial debt alleviation?

The term " financial obligation alleviation" can mean many different things, but the major goal of any kind of financial debt alleviation option is normally to transform the terms or amount of your financial debt so you can come back on your feet faster.

Financial obligation relief could include:

Working out with financial institutions to clear up the financial debt for less than the sum total owed.

Wiping the financial debt out entirely in bankruptcy.

Utilizing a debt management plan to obtain modifications in your rate of interest or payment timetable.

When should you look for financial obligation alleviation?

Take into consideration DIY financial debt relief, insolvency or financial obligation monitoring when either of these is true:

You have no hope of settling unsafe financial obligation (credit cards, medical costs, individual finances) within 5 years, even if you take severe procedures to cut spending.

The total amount of your overdue unsafe financial obligation ( leaving out student finance debt) equates to fifty percent or more of your gross income.

What are the financial obligation alleviation choices to consider?

Do-it-yourself debt relief

You can avoid an official debt-relief program and deal with debt on your own via a combination of stricter budgeting, credit scores therapy, debt combination and appeals to creditors.

For instance, you can do what debt therapists do in financial obligation management plans: Get in touch with your lenders, describe why you fell behind and what concessions you need to catch up. A lot of charge card companies have challenge programs, and they might be willing to lower your rate of interest and waive charges.

You can likewise educate yourself on financial debt settlement and work out an arrangement by getting in touch with creditors.

If your debt isn't as well huge, conventional debt-payoff techniques may be offered. For instance, depending on your credit score, you may be able to obtain a 0% equilibrium transfer charge card.

That indicates relocating your financial debt from a higher-interest credit card to a card with a 0% initial interest rate, or APR. The interest-free period implies your whole repayment goes to lowering the balance, making faster progression. Or you might find a financial debt combination car loan with a reduced interest rate than you're paying currently.

Those choices will not hurt your credit; as long as you make the repayments by the end of the marketing period, your credit score ought to rebound. If you go this course, nonetheless, it is very important to have a strategy to avoid including more bank card debt.

Debt management strategies

A financial obligation administration strategy allows you to pay your unsafe debts-- commonly credit cards-- completely, but often at a reduced rates of interest or with fees waived. You make a solitary settlement monthly to a credit counseling agency, which disperses it amongst your creditors. Credit history counselors and charge card firms have arrangements in place to assist financial debt administration customers.

Your credit card accounts will be closed and, most of the times, you'll have to live without charge card up until you complete the strategy.

Debt management strategies do not influence your credit rating, however closing accounts can injure your scores. Once you've finished the strategy, you can make an application for credit history once again.

Missing settlements can knock you out of the strategy, though. And it is very important to choose an company accredited by the National Structure for Credit Rating Counseling or the Financial Counseling Association of America.

As constantly, see to it you recognize the charges and what choices you might have for managing financial debt.

Financial debt alleviation through insolvency

There's little point in going into a financial obligation management strategy if you're not mosting likely to have the ability to pay as concurred. Talk with a personal bankruptcy lawyer initially. Initial assessments are often complimentary, and if you do not certify, you can move on to other options.

Chapter 7 personal bankruptcy

The most typical type of personal bankruptcy, Phase 7 liquidation, can get rid of most charge card debt, unprotected individual finances and medical debt. It can be carried out in three or 4 months if you qualify. What you should know:

It will not eliminate youngster assistance commitments.

It will certainly injure your credit history and stay on your debt report for as much as ten years. Nonetheless, if your debt is currently damaged, a personal bankruptcy may allow you to rebuild much sooner than if you keep having problem with settlement.

If you have used a co-signer, your bankruptcy declaring will make that co-signer entirely in charge of the financial debt.

If debts remain to accumulate, you can't submit one more Chapter 7 insolvency for eight years.

It might not be the right choice if you would have to quit residential or commercial property you intend to maintain. The policies vary by state. Generally, specific type of residential property are exempt from bankruptcy, such as cars up to a particular worth and part of the equity in your house.

It may not be essential if you do not have any kind of income or residential property a financial institution can pursue.

Phase 13 bankruptcy

Not everybody with overwhelming financial obligation gets approved for Chapter 7. If your earnings is above the typical for your state and family size, or you have a home you wish to save from repossession, you might require to declare Chapter 13 bankruptcy.

Phase 13 is a 3- or five-year court-approved repayment plan, based on your revenue and debts. If you have the ability to stick with Avoiding Default the prepare for its full term, the remaining unsafe financial debt is released.

If you have the ability to stay up to date with payments (a majority of individuals are not), you will reach keep your property. A Chapter 13 personal bankruptcy remains on your debt report for 7 years from the filing date.

Debt settlement: A dangerous choice

Financial debt negotiation is a last hope for those who encounter frustrating debt yet can not receive bankruptcy or don't intend to file bankruptcy.

Debt negotiation firms usually ask you to stop making financial debt repayments when you enlist in a negotiation plan and instead placed the money in an escrow account, the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au states.

Each financial institution is approached as the cash builds up in your account and you fall even more behind on settlements. Fear of obtaining nothing in any way may motivate the financial institution to accept a smaller sized lump-sum offer and concur not to pursue you for the remainder.

Why this option is high-risk

You could wind up with financial debts that are even larger than when you began as late charges, interest and other charges connected to credit card financial debt balloon.

Not paying your bills can cause collections calls, fine charges and, potentially, lawsuit against you. Lawsuits can lead to wage garnishments and residential or commercial property liens. Debt settlement quits none of that while you're still negotiating, and it can take months for the negotiation offers to begin.

If your financial obligation is cleared up, you might likewise encounter a bill for taxes on the forgiven amounts (which the internal revenue service counts as revenue).

The debt settlement service is riddled with bad actors, and the CFPB, the National Customer Regulation Facility and the Federal Trade Payment caution consumers about it in the greatest possible terms.

Some financial debt settlement business also advertise themselves as debt combination business. They are not. Financial debt combination is something you can do on your own, and it will not harm your credit scores.

Debt relief scams to keep an eye out for

Financial obligation relief might offer you the brand-new start you need to make real development. Yet be aware that the financial obligation relief industry includes scammers who may try to take what little cash you have.

Make sure you recognize-- and verify-- these points prior to entering any contract with a financial obligation negotiation company:

What you need to qualify.

What charges you will certainly pay.

Which creditors are being paid, and just how much. If your financial obligation is in collections, make sure you comprehend who possesses the financial debt so settlements go to the best agency.

The tax obligation implications.

Whether the company you pick works with the lenders you owe.

Stay clear of financial obligation relief programs that promise to do any of the following:

Make you pay a charge before your debt is resolved.

Guarantee a " also good to be true" price for repaying your financial debt.

Guarantee you that it can quit all lawsuits and calls from financial debt enthusiasts.

Financial debt alleviation alternatives to prevent

Occasionally frustrating debt comes with devastating speed-- a health dilemma, unemployment or a all-natural catastrophe. Or possibly it came a little each time, and now creditors and collection agencies are pressing you to pay, and you simply can't.

If you're really feeling overwhelmed by debt, here are some things to stay clear of ideally:

Do not neglect a secured debt (like a car payment) in order to pay an unprotected one (like a health center expense or charge card). You can lose the collateral that secures that debt, in this situation your cars and truck.

Do not obtain versus the equity in your home. You're placing your home in jeopardy of foreclosure and you might be turning unsecured financial obligation that could be wiped out in personal bankruptcy right into safeguarded financial obligation that can not.

Think twice about borrowing money from workplace pension when possible. If you lose your task, the loans can end up being inadvertent withdrawals and set off a tax costs.

Do not choose based upon which collection agencies are pressuring you one of the most. Instead, require time to investigate your choices and choose the very best one for your scenario.
